Answer:

[tex]\large\text{$ x^{\frac{21}{25}} $}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given expression:

[tex]\large \text{$ \left(x^{\frac{3}{5}}\right)^{\frac{7}{5}} $}[/tex]

[tex]\textsf{Apply exponent rule} \quad (a^b)^c=a^{bc}:[/tex]

[tex]\implies \large \text{$ x^\left(\frac{3}{5} \times \frac{7}{5}\right) $}[/tex]

[tex]\implies \large \text{$ x^{\frac{21}{25}} $}[/tex]
